Study the following information carefully and answer the questions given below:
Six cars i.e. M, S, R, T, Q and P which are parked in a parking area in a straight path such that the distance between a car and its adjacent cars is same for all the cars at the instant when they all are parked in a straight line. (i.e. Distance between car Mand car Pis equal to the distance between car Pand car Sif Mand Sare adjacent to P). All cars front side are facing in the north direction. Car Pis parked third to the left of car Q. Car R is parked third to the right of car M. Car P is placed between car S and car R. Car P takes a U turn and started moving and covers distance of 8 unit to reach point A. From point A Car P takes `135^(@)` right turn and then again covers 10 unit to reach at the point where car Mis parked. Car Pagain covers 4 unit in the north direction from the point Where car M is parked to reach point K. CarQ starts moving in the north direction and covers a certain distance to reach point L.
Point A is in which direction with respect to the car P final position?

A

South

B

South-west

C

North

D

None of these

Text Solution

Verified by Experts

The correct Answer is:
D

Step 1:- From the given statements, the distance between a car and its adjacent cars is same for all the cars at the instant when they all are parked in a straight line. All cars front side are facing in the north direction. Car R is parked third to the right of car M. Car P is placed between car S and car R so there will be two possible cases

Step II :- Now from the given condition Car Pis parked third to the left of car Q case 1 will be eliminated and we get the final positions of cars in the parking area.

Step III :- Now we will determine the distance between the adjacent cars,
Car P moved 8 unit towards south direction (as it takes U turn from its initial position) to reach point A From point A Car P takes 135o right turn and then again covers 10 unit to reach at the point where car M is parked. Car P again covers 4 unit in the north direction from the last position to reach point K. Car Q starts moving in the north direction and covers a certain distance to reach point L.
Shortest distance between point A and car M initial) is 10 unit.
By using Pythagoras theorem,
The distance between Car M and initial position of car `P =sqrt((100-64))=sqrt((36))=6` unit
So 2x = 6 unit
(Where x, is distance between two adjacent cars)
x= 3 unit,
